Patriots Win Thriller Against Fresno State

The Dallas Baptist Patriot Baseball Team traveled to Fresno, California on Thursday, for a three game series against Fresno State University. The Patriots captured game one from the Bulldogs with a 13-9 victory, and with the win, improve to 24-17 on the season.

Junior Jared Stafford picked up his fourth win of the season, after pitching four innings, allowing three runs on three hits, and striking out five.

After a scoreless first, the Patriots took a 1-0 lead in the top of the second off the bat of Junior Logan Moro. Sophomore Ryan Behmanesh led off the inning with a walk, later advanced to second, and finally scored when Moro connected on a single to center field, giving the Patriots the early lead.

A two run second by the Bulldogs gave the lead back to Fresno State, but the Patriots responded in the third with another run to tie the game at 2-2. With two outs and no men on, Freshman Austin Elkins hit his seventh homerun of the season, a solo shot to right field, to even the game.

The tie game didn't last long, as Fresno hit back-to-back homeruns to lead off the bottom of the third, chasing Lane from the mound, and giving the Bulldogs a 4-2 lead. A single later in the inning made it a 5-2 lead for the Bulldogs.

Senior Ryan Enos doubled in the fifth and later scored for the Patriots on a RBI single by Behmanesh, his 33rd RBI of the season, to trim the deficit to 5-3.

The Patriots finally regained the lead in the top of the sixth, scoring three runs. Moro scored on a wild pitch, and Enos picked up two RBI later in the inning with a single, scoring Junior Tyler Robbins and Senior Austin Knight, giving the Patriots the 6-5 advantage.

With the game tied 6-6, the Patriots moved in front again in the eighth, scoring two runs. With runners on second and third and only one out, Junior Jason Krizan grounded out to second base, scoring Knight. Enos picked up yet another RBI on a single to score Robbins, giving the Patriots an 8-6 lead heading into the ninth.

Robbins gave the Patriots a little more breathing room in the top of the ninth with his 31st RBI of the season, a single to right field, to make it a 9-6 game, but Fresno responded in the bottom of the inning. The Bulldogs blasted two homeruns to tie the game at nine, and send it to extra innings.

With two men on in the tenth, Freshman Duncan McAlpine stepped to the plate and delivered his 12th homerun of the season to give the Patriots the lead for good. Robbins added another RBI to make it a four run lead for DBU, and Stafford retired the side in the bottom half of the inning, leaving the Patriots with the 13-9 win.

The Patriots will return to action tomorrow evening, as they prepare for game two against the Bulldogs at Beiden Field. The game is scheduled to begin at 8:05 Central Time.
